CAIRO - 3 April 2020: The Cabinet information center denied upping taxes levied on civil servants by 13 percent in the 2021-2022 budget, according to its statement on Saturday.


The center said it communicated with the Finance Ministry which dismissed the news as baseless.

The ministry stressed that there is no intention to raise taxes on people.

The ministry called on media to verify the authenticity of information to avoid spreading rumors.
